Technique

The Japanese paper has got almost an infinite number of variations. It is smooth and coarse, shiny and matt, transparent or thick. It can be dyed, decorated and used for instance in design. The technology of paper making in Japan has been on the highest level for several hundreds of years. Both Rembrandt, as well as Picasso appreciated the quality and properties offered by washi. Pattern

One of the motifs inseparably linked with Japan is the blooming cherry tree, however it is only one among thousands of symbols, which decorate the Japanese handmade paper and give it a unique look. High quality merged with original patterns allow to produce exceptional items, other than the ones made in Europe – they truly reflect the spirit of the Far East.

Mizutama – a decorative fishnet-like paper. Patterns resemble lace and are created by falling drops of water.

Chiyogami – a decorative paper, frequently richly ornamented with gilded elements. Used in bookbinding and such industrial crafts as the production of jewellery, boxes, exclusive packaging or greeting cards.
